1. Boost Immunity with Beta-Glucans

Mushrooms like shiitake, reishi, and maitake are rich in beta-glucans, a type of soluble fiber that has been shown to boost immune function. Beta-glucans help to stimulate the production of immune cells, enhancing the body’s ability to fight off infections and diseases. Incorporating these mushrooms into your meals can be as simple as adding them to soups, stews, or stir-fries. 2. Enhance Brain Function with Lion’s Mane

Lion’s Mane mushroom is gaining popularity for its potential cognitive benefits. Research shows that Lion’s Mane may stimulate the growth of nerve cells, which could improve memory, focus, and overall brain function. 3. Support Heart Health with Antioxidants

Certain mushrooms, such as oyster and shiitake, are packed with antioxidants that help reduce oxidative stress, a key contributor to heart disease. They are also a good source of potassium, which helps regulate blood pressure. By including mushrooms in your diet, you can support heart health naturally. 4. Improve Gut Health with Prebiotic Fibers

Mushrooms are rich in prebiotics—fibers that feed the beneficial bacteria in your gut. A healthy gut microbiome is essential for digestion, immunity, and even mood regulation. Incorporating mushrooms like button mushrooms or shiitake into your meals can promote a balanced gut flora. 5. Boost Energy Levels with B Vitamins

Many types of mushrooms are loaded with B vitamins, including riboflavin, niacin, and pantothenic acid, which are essential for energy production. These vitamins help convert the food you eat into usable energy and play a crucial role in reducing fatigue. 6. Promote Weight Loss with Low-Calorie, Nutrient-Dense Foods

Mushrooms are naturally low in calories yet high in essential nutrients like v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. Their high fiber content also promotes feelings of fullness, which can help you manage your weight. 7. Reduce Inflammation with Anti-Inflammatory Properties

Mushrooms like reishi and chaga are known for their powerful anti-inflammatory properties. Chronic inflammation is linked to a range of health problems, including heart disease, diabetes, and arthritis. By incorporating these mushrooms into your diet, you can help your body manage inflammation more effectively.
